As we move through the final months of 2025, the Royal Signals Charity extends its heartfelt thanks to everyone who has stood with us this year. Your generosity, compassion, and dedication have made a real and lasting difference in the lives of those within the Royal Corps of Signals family.

Your Support in Action

In the first 7 months of 2025, the Charity has directly supported 626 individuals, and many more have benefited indirectly through wider welfare and support initiatives. Thanks to your donations and fundraising efforts, just under £165,500 has been awarded in benevolence grants this year.

Of these grants:

  • 10% went to serving soldiers, providing support to those still wearing the uniform.
  • 17% were awarded to individuals over the age of 67, many of whom believed they would never need help.

This highlights an important truth: it’s often the generation that believes they won’t need support who end up needing it most.
